One key trend in the China RT PCR technology market is the growing demand for automation and multiplex PCR systems. Automation improves the efficiency and throughput of laboratories, while multiplex PCR allows for the simultaneous detection of multiple pathogens or genetic markers, making testing faster and more cost-effective. This trend is particularly noticeable in hospital laboratories, where the volume of tests is high, and accuracy is paramount. Automation also reduces human error, ensuring that results are consistently reliable, which is crucial for both diagnostic and research purposes. These systems are becoming more affordable and accessible to smaller laboratories and clinics, further driving adoption across the healthcare sector.

1. What is RT PCR technology?
RT PCR (Reverse Transcription Polymerase Chain Reaction) is a laboratory technique used to detect and amplify RNA sequences, commonly used for molecular diagnostics and research.
2. How does RT PCR work?
RT PCR works by converting RNA into complementary DNA (cDNA) using reverse transcription and then amplifying the cDNA to detectable levels through polymerase chain reaction.
3. What are the key applications of RT PCR in China?
RT PCR is used in diagnostics for infectious diseases, genetic testing, cancer research, and personalized medicine, particularly in hospitals, clinics, and research facilities.
4. Why is RT PCR important for detecting COVID-19?
RT PCR is the gold standard for COVID-19 testing because it is highly accurate in detecting the RNA of the virus even in asymptomatic or low viral load cases.
5. Is RT PCR technology only used for infectious disease testing?
While RT PCR is commonly used for infectious disease testing, it is also widely used in genetic testing, cancer diagnostics, and research related to gene expression and molecular biology.
6. What are the benefits of automated RT PCR systems?
Automated RT PCR systems improve efficiency, reduce human error, increase throughput, and ensure consistent and reliable test results, particularly in high-volume settings like hospitals.
7. How does RT PCR contribute to personalized medicine?
RT PCR allows for precise genetic analysis, enabling personalized treatment plans based on an individual’s genetic profile, which can improve treatment outcomes and reduce side effects.
8. What is the future outlook for RT PCR technology in China?
The future of RT PCR technology in China is promising, with expected growth driven by increasing demand for diagnostics in hospitals, clinics, and research settings, as well as advancements in testing capabilities.
9. What challenges does the RT PCR market face in China?
Challenges in the RT PCR market include the high cost of equipment and consumables, the need for skilled personnel, and the potential for test errors due to contamination or improper handling.
10. How is RT PCR technology used in research?
RT PCR is used in research to study gene expression, detect mutations, understand disease mechanisms, and develop new therapies, particularly in genomics and infectious disease research.
